Automation of Technological Processes and Production - 60710900
Bachelor’s Degree Program
Degree: Bachelor
Mode of Study: Full-time
Duration: 4 years
Educational System: Credit-module system
Program Overview
The bachelor’s program “Automation of Technological Processes and Production (60710900)” prepares highly qualified engineers capable of designing, implementing and managing automated production systems, digital technologies, and intelligent industrial solutions.
The program focuses on industrial automation, control systems, robotics, electronic devices, process optimization and digital transformation of production environments.
Students gain the knowledge and practical skills required for developing efficient, reliable and sustainable automated systems in industrial and agricultural sectors.
Main Areas of Study
Students develop competencies in:
- Engineering and computer graphics;
- Theoretical mechanics;
- Electrical engineering and electronics;
- Elements and devices of automation systems;
- Computer systems and networks;
- Industrial measurement technologies;
- Automatic control theory;
- Process modeling and optimization;
- Design of automation systems;
- Installation and configuration of control systems;
- Digital production technologies;
- Smart manufacturing systems.
Practical Training
Students receive practical experience in modern laboratories, industrial enterprises, engineering centers and research facilities.
They learn to:
- Design automated control systems;
- Operate sensors and control devices;
- Monitor technological processes;
- Apply programmable control systems;
- Digitalize production processes;
- Implement resource-efficient technologies;
- Configure and maintain automation systems.
Career Opportunities
Graduates can work in:
- Industrial enterprises;
- Agricultural automation systems;
- Food production companies;
- Robotics and automation companies;
- Energy and technological complexes;
- Engineering and design organizations;
- Research institutions;
- Digital manufacturing and industrial management sectors.
Importance of the Field
Automation of technological processes and production is a key discipline of modern engineering, contributing to increased productivity, improved product quality, reduced human workload and development of the digital economy.
